  • Do you refresh file name data base (go to MikTeX Settings and than click on Refresh FNDB and after then on Update Formats)? – Zarko Dec 18 '15 at 19:33
  • You have to install it as IEEEtran.cls. Not the uppercase letters! Then go to the MikTeX update manager and refresh the file name database (FNDB). It is on the top of the window. –  Dec 18 '15 at 19:51

If you are an Ubuntu, Debian or Linux Mint user try this:

sudo apt-get install texlive-publishers

You can simply download the folder in this link https://ctan.org/tex-archive/macros/latex/contrib/IEEEtran?lang=en;

Then, you have to copy the file IEEEtran to the folder where your working file are in. Have a nice day.
